The FID 22 m NMHC Analyser measures the total hydrocarbon content (THC) as well as the Methane content and calculates the non-methane hydrocarbons concentration (NMHC).
The FID 22 NMHC (rack variant) analyser is used for continuous monitoring of the content of hydrocarbons (THC)/ Total Organic Carbon (TOC), Methane (CH4) and Non-Methane Hydrocarbons (NMHC) in gases from industrial plants (emissions) or environments (immissions).

The AP-380 Series Air Quality Monitors utilize the trace concentration gas measurement technology that HORIBA has cultivated over 60 years in air pollution monitoring and measurement to achieve high-sensitivity continuous measurement in the ppb to ppm range.
The APCA-370 is a device for continuous CO2 monitoring in ambient air. It uses cross modulation type non-dispersive infrared (NDIR) absorption method.
The APHA-380 is an analyser for measuring hydrocarbon in ambient air and other background gases, for air quality control as well as for variety of industrial applications.
